I just want to echo AP 6380's comments. Erice is probably one of the worst places to use as a base. The drive up the mountain is about 35-40 minutes. Then parking is outside the City wall so you'll have to walk a good distance. Trapani, Marsala, Selinunte, or even Scopello or Castellmare di Golfo would make better as a "jumping post."
I also agree with RAR (as I usually do about Sicily) in regard to Agrigento. It is a beautiful sight and worth the trip; but Selinunte and Segesta also have beautifully preserved temples and a Greek theatre, without the crowds.
